## Market Summary

## **Sports Management Software Market Overview**

Sports Management Software Market is projected to grow from USD **12.22 Billion** in 2025 to USD **19.32 Billion** by 2034,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of **5.22%** during the forecast period (2025 - 2034). Additionally, the market size for Sports Management Software Market was valued at USD 11.61 billion in 2024.

## **Key Sports Management Software Market Trends Highlighted**

Key market drivers for sports management software include the growing popularity of sports, increasing investment in sports infrastructure, and the need for effective athlete management. Opportunities arise in data analytics, injury prevention, and athlete performance optimization. Recent trends have emphasized the adoption of cloud-based solutions, mobile applications, and wearable technology. Cloud computing offers flexibility, scalability, and cost-effective access to software. Mobile apps empower athletes and coaches to access information and manage schedules on the go. Wearable technology enables real-time data collection and analysis, providing valuable insights into athlete performance and recovery.

These advancements en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of sports management operations.

A notable example of a leading company in the Sports Management Software Market is TeamSnap, which has established itself as a prominent player in the industry. The company offers a comprehensive suite of software solutions designed specifically for youth sports organizations. TeamSnap's software helps teams manage schedules, rosters, payments, and communication, streamlining operations and enhancing overall efficiency. The company's commitment to innovation and customer satisfaction has contributed to its strong market position. TeamSnap's software is used by over 20 million coaches, parents, and athletes worldwide, making it one of the most popular sports management software solutions available.

On the other hand, a significant competitor in the Sports Management Software Market is SportsEngine. The company provides a comprehensive platform for sports organizations of all sizes, from youth leagues to professional teams. SportsEngine's software includes features such as team management, event scheduling, registration and payment processing, website creation, and mobile applications. The company's focus on providing a user-friendly and feature-rich platform has made it a popular choice among sports organizations looking to streamline their operations and improve their overall performance. SportsEngine's software is used by over 1 million sports organizations worldwide, making it a formidable competitor in the market.

## Regional Market Share Analysis

### North America : Market Leader in Software Solutions

North America is the largest market for sports management software, holding approximately 60% of the global market share. The region's growth is driven by increasing participation in sports, rising demand for efficient management solutions, and supportive regulations promoting youth sports. The U.S. leads this market, followed closely by Canada, which contributes around 15% to the overall market share. The competitive landscape is robust, featuring key players like TeamSnap, SportsEngine, and Active Network. These companies are leveraging technology to enhance user experience and streamline operations for sports organizations. The presence of numerous startups and established firms fosters innovation, making North America a hub for sports management software development.

### Europe : Emerging Market with Growth Potential

Europe is witnessing significant growth in the sports management software market, accounting for approximately 25% of the global share. The increasing focus on sports participation and the need for efficient management tools are key drivers. Countries like the UK and Germany are at the forefront, with regulatory support for sports initiatives enhancing market demand. The region is expected to see a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 10% over the next few years. Leading countries in this market include the UK, Germany, and France, where established players like LeagueApps and Stack Sports are making strides.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of local and international firms, fostering innovation and tailored solutions for diverse sports organizations. The European market is poised for further expansion as digital transformation continues to reshape the sports industry.
